Mauro Icardi: A Career in Flux
Mauro Icardi has become a figure of intrigue, often overshadowed by his off-field controversies rather than his footballing prowess. After a remarkable 2023/2024 season at Galatasaray, where he netted 25 goals and assisted 9 times in the league, his career trajectory hit a bump when a serious injury occurred. Compounding these on-pitch challenges, his high-profile romantic life, notably his tumultuous divorce from Wanda Nara and subsequent relationship with the celebrity Eugenia “China” Suarez, has dominated headlines, contributing to a perception that distracts from his athletic achievements.
Contractual Discontent
Icardi’s current contract with Galatasaray runs until 2026. However, various reports, particularly from Argentine media outlets like El Grafico, indicate that the Turkish club is willing to offer him a two-year contract extension. The catch? A substantial salary reduction—up to 50%. This condition has led Icardi to contemplate a departure, as he weighs his options carefully.
Exploring Options: A Return to Spain?
At just 32 years old, Icardi is at a crossroads but has no shortage of potential destinations. There’s significant chatter in South America about a potential return, with River Plate emerging as a leading candidate. Additionally, speculation around a homecoming to Rosario with Newell’s Old Boys has generated excitement among fans.
On the European front, two clubs in Spain’s La Liga—Elche and Oviedo—are reportedly vying for his signature. Despite these clubs lacking glamour, his partner’s preference to move to Spain could influence his decision.
Declining Exotic Offers
Interestingly, Icardi has made it clear he is not keen on joining leagues viewed as ‘exotic,’ having turned down lucrative offers from Saudi Arabia and Qatar. These spots may promise financial rewards but lack the competitive allure that Icardi seeks. Furthermore, with his last appearance for the Argentina national team dating back to 2018, he’s likely keeping the World Cup aspirations in mind, which may affect his next move.
